Hey there- Just joined and got access to the forums. I'm a first time Olds owner, bought a 1970 Cutlass Supreme a couple days ago. Planning on a restoration to get her road worthy again. Rust in all the usual spots, Olds 350 with a casting code that puts the engine between a 1977 and a 1980, TH350 trans, 12 bolt rear. Not sure of the gears yet. I want to try and decode the build tag, I'll find the correct forum to post that question later today. But in the mean time, thought I'd cruise the site a bit, see what's going on here. Thanks!
